Activision Rebuts Uvalde Lawsuit, Citing First Amendment Protections for Call of Duty

Activision Blizzard has filed a robust defense against lawsuits filed by Uvalde school shooting victims' families, vehemently denying any causal link between its Call of Duty franchise and the tragedy. The May 2024 lawsuits allege the shooter's exposure to Call of Duty's violent content contributed to the massacre at Robb Elementary School on May 24, 2022, where 19 children and two teachers perished. The shooter, a former Robb Elementary student, had played Call of Duty, including Modern Warfare, and used an AR-15 rifle, similar to those depicted in the game. The plaintiffs contend Activision and Meta (via Instagram advertising) fostered a harmful environment encouraging violent behavior in vulnerable youth.

Activision's December filing, a comprehensive 150-page response, refutes all claims. The company asserts the absence of a direct causal relationship between Call of Duty and the shooting, invoking California's anti-SLAPP laws to protect free speech. The publisher further emphasizes Call of Duty's status as expressive content protected under the First Amendment, arguing that accusations based on "hyper-realistic content" violate this fundamental right.

Expert Testimony Bolsters Activision's Defense

Supporting its defense, Activision submitted declarations from key figures. Notre Dame professor Matthew Thomas Payne's 35-page statement contextualizes Call of Duty within the established tradition of military realism in film and television, directly countering the lawsuit's "training camp" assertion. Patrick Kelly, Call of Duty's head of creative, contributed a 38-page document detailing the game's development, including the substantial $700 million budget allocated to Call of Duty: Black Ops Cold War.

The Uvalde families have until late February to respond to Activision's extensive documentation. The outcome remains uncertain, but the case highlights the ongoing debate surrounding the connection between violent video games and mass shootings, a recurring theme in similar legal battles.
